ARKO Petroleum Prices 11.11M Shares at $18.00
ARKO Petroleum (APC) priced 11.11M shares at $18.00. The deal size was increased from 10.5M shares and priced at the low end of the $18.00-$20.00 target range. UBS, Raymond James, Stifel, Mizuho and Capital One are acting as joint book running managers for the offering. ARKO Petroleum, a fuel distribution company, is one of the largest wholesale fuel distributors by gallons in North America, supplying customers in more than 30 states across the Mid-Atlantic, Midwestern, Northeastern, Southeastern, and Southwestern United States. Upon the completion of the IPO, ARKO Corp. (ARKO) is expected to own 35M shares of APC's Class B common stock, representing 75.9% of the economic interests in APC and 94.0% of the combined voting power of APC's Class A common stock and Class B common stock or 73.3% of the economic interests in APC and 93.2% of the combined voting power if the underwriters exercise their over-allotment.

- Fuel Cost Savings: ARKO Corp's 'Fueling America's Future' program allows fas REWARDS® members to save up to $2.50 per gallon on fuel, with a maximum of 20 gallons, translating to a potential $50 savings on a full tank, significantly alleviating household fuel expenses during challenging economic times.
- Membership Reward System: By purchasing designated items in-store, fas REWARDS® members can accumulate cents-off-per-gallon rewards in their virtual wallets, which are automatically applied at the pump, enhancing customer experience and loyalty.
- Nationwide Promotion: This initiative will be available throughout 2026 across ARKO's more than 1,000 convenience stores, aiming to provide substantial economic relief to consumers nationwide, particularly amidst rising household costs.
- Corporate Social Responsibility: CEO Arie Kotler emphasized that this initiative not only celebrates America's 250th anniversary but also aims to provide tangible support to families during tough economic times, reflecting the company's commitment to the communities it serves.

- Successful IPO Completion: ARKO Petroleum Corp. successfully completed a $200 million initial public offering (IPO), generating approximately $183.2 million in net proceeds, reflecting strong market confidence in its business model.
- Stock Issuance Details: The IPO involved the issuance of 11,111,111 shares of Class A common stock priced at $18 per share, with trading commencing on February 12 on the Nasdaq Capital Market, marking a significant step in the company's capital market journey.
- Shareholder Structure: At the close of the IPO, ARKO Corp. owned about 75.9% of ARKO Petroleum's economic interest and 94% of the voting power, ensuring control over the company and enhancing its competitive position in the industry.
